Use the designated immersion point

Many gram panchayats and municipalities set aside a pond or a marked stretch of tank for immersion. Ask at the panchayat office — it changes year to year, and a drinking-water tank or a farm pond is not an alternative.

Unpainted clay dissolves, plaster of Paris does not

A clay idol breaks down in water within hours. Plaster of Paris does not, and the paints carry heavy metals, so idols accumulate in tanks and rivers after immersion. Pollution control boards in most states now ask for clay for exactly this reason.

Someone should be watching the water, not the idol

Immersion points get crowded and the bank is slippery after the monsoon. Children go into the water at these gatherings every year. Keep one person watching the water rather than the procession.

Take the accessories home

Thermocol, plastic sheeting, cloth and metal ornaments do not belong in the tank even when the idol itself is clay. Most organised immersion points now have a collection bin at the bank for them.

Karena at a glance

Karena is a village of 1,082 people in 242 households (Census 2011) in Amod taluka, Bharuch district, Gujarat, the 26th-largest of 52 villages in Amod taluka. Literacy is 70%, about the same as the taluka average of 69% and the sex ratio is 939 women per 1,000 men. The pincode is 392025, served by Samni post office; the LGD village code is 521971.
